Netflix is ​​Sharing A FIRST LOOK AT ITS UPCOMING SERIES BASED ON JUDY BLUME’S 1975 NOVEL, Forever.

The Series Will Follow The Love Story Their Lives. Forever Will Be Set in 2018 Los Angeles.

Simone Will Play Keisha Clark, A Confident Track Star with Dreams for Life After High School. Meanwhile, Cooper Jr. Will Portray Justin Edwards, Who Dreams of Playing Division-One Basketball and Achieving More than His Successful Parents.

Mara Brock Akil, Known for Creating the Sitcom Girlfriends and the Drama Being Mary JanE, Serves As the Show’s Executive Producer and ShowRunner. Forever is Akil’s First Project Under Her Overall Deal with Netflix. Judy Blume, Susie Fitzgerald, Erika Harrison, Sara White, Regina King, Shana C. Waterman and Anthony Hemingway Serve as Executive Producers.

King Will Direct The First Episode.

Karen Pittman, Wood Harris, Xosha Roquemore, Marvin Lawrence Winans III, Barry Shabaka Henley, Ali Gallo, Niles Fitch, Paigion Walker and E’Myri Crutchfield Also.

Forever Marks One of the Myriad of Books Set to be adapted for the screen this year.

Blume’s Are you there god? IT’s ME, Margaret Was Previoously Adapted for A 2023 Feature Film.

Forever Will Stream on Netflix on May 8.
